Interesting facts
1

The temple idol is carved from a single piece of stone and depicts the Sun God in a seated, meditative pose.

2

It is historically significant as the only Surya temple in Kerala where the deity is worshipped in a standard temple complex format.

3

The temple layout adheres to specific Vastu Shastra principles suited for a solar-focused shrine.

4

The temple pond, known as the Suryatheertham, is considered sacred by local devotees.

Overview

Adithyapuram Suryadeva Temple is one of the few shrines in India exclusively dedicated to the Sun God, Surya. The temple follows a unique architectural style where the idol of the deity faces west rather than the traditional east. It is situated in the Kottayam district of Kerala, specifically within the Kaduthuruthy region. The sanctum sanctorum houses a unique stone idol representing Surya in a meditative posture. Devotees traditionally visit this temple seeking relief from eye-related ailments and skin conditions. The temple is surrounded by a dense green grove, contributing to its tranquil environment. The annual festival, centered around the solar transit, attracts large gatherings of pilgrims.

Insider tips

Remove footwear outside the designated area before entering the temple complex.

Check the local Malayalam calendar for the dates of the annual 'Adithyotsavam' festival to avoid or join the crowds.

Maintain silence while inside the inner temple courtyard to respect the meditative environment.

What to avoid

Do not attempt to take photographs inside the sanctum sanctorum or near the main deity idol.

Etiquette

Strict dress code applies: men must wear mundu (traditional lower garment) and remove shirts, while women should wear modest traditional attire like sarees or long skirts.
